    Today we're announcing Tiny Prison, an upcoming release for iOS and Android phones and tablets.

    Tiny Prison is a casual sim where you play the Warden and manage your own prison!

    Game Trailer: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=ETA3n-ejkzI

    [​IMG]



    [​IMG]



    [​IMG]



    [​IMG]



    [​IMG]


    FEATURES

    [-]Build floors
    [-]Upgrade your prison
    [-]Hire guards and stop prison riots
    [-]Complete special events for the governor
    [-]Search for contraband
    [-]Parole prisoners or send them to death row…

  4. Tiny Prison is trying something a little different with the pay model. It does have a freemium element, but I would call it Shareware + Freemium. The game is free to download and there is a one time $1.99 purchase of an expansion that offers additional features. This feels like a win-win to me, because the customer can try the game for free, and we can reach more customers and give them a chance to make a purchase that they might have never made otherwise. At that point there is still a classic freemium model but for those that don't like to participate, you will not hit any sort of pay walls that try to squeeze you into spending another dollar.

    If I was a customer of this game I would only be spending $2 and I imagine that most of the gamers on this forum have a similar disposition.
